I have an 02 Omega2.6 v6 Estate, yesterday I found that I have a large pool of water in the rear nearside passenger footwell. Dried it out the best I could yesterday, checked the car this morning to find it just as wet again.....it has been raining quite hard over night and the car is not garaged. Has anybody else had similar issues, if so any suggestions???

I would agree. Probably a blocked scuttle drain. >:(

A common problem with the Omega and although the water comes in to the front passenger compartment it quickly water logs the sound insulation and flows to the rear passenger compartment.
